Transaction 1301628c17541dd411c63d16ab217ac72cf7f0998285f5aa3cc038d89df63a17
1 Input
1 Output
-
1301628c17541dd411c63d16ab217ac72cf7f0998285f5aa3cc038d89df63a17:0
- value
- 146049
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dced2f77204d1427c91a93fbf3b119a14b9aa2a OP_EQUAL
- address
- 3BhdLqqbZDPUY4VKfKs6mMuctZJSj6Qwsq